Testowanie 2025, Styczeń
W tym samouczku dowiesz się, jak zmaksymalizować, zminimalizować lub zmienić rozmiar przeglądarki za pomocą selenu Webdriver. Wyjaśniono w różnych scenariuszach przy użyciu metody maximize () i wymiarów do zmiany rozmiaru
W tym samouczku dowiesz się, jak zintegrować Cucumber z Selenium Webdriver. Co to jest ogórek? Cucumber to podejście do testowania, które wspiera rozwój oparty na zachowaniu (BDD). To wyjaśnia b
Punkty przerwania selenium służą do sprawdzania wykonania kodu. Za każdym razem, gdy zaimplementujesz punkt przerwania w kodzie, wykonywanie zostanie zatrzymane.
Dowiedz się, jak utworzyć swój pierwszy skrypt w Selenium IDE, nagrywając. Korzystając z funkcji odtwarzania, możesz wykonać swój skrypt i polecenia (asercje, akcje).
W tym samouczku nauczymy się, poleceń przechowywania, poleceń echa, obsługi alertów i wyskakujących okienek, potwierdzeń i wielu okien.
W tym samouczku przyjrzymy się poleceniom, które sprawią, że Twój skrypt automatyzacji będzie bardziej inteligentny i kompletny.
Selenium IDE (Integrated Development Environment) to najprostsze narzędzie w pakiecie Selenium Suite. Jest to dodatek do Firefoksa, który bardzo szybko tworzy testy dzięki funkcji nagrywania i odtwarzania.
Ten samouczek przedstawia procedurę pobierania i instalacji Selenium IDE w przeglądarce Firefox. Selenium IDE to zintegrowane środowisko programistyczne dla skryptów Selenium.
Co to są wyjątki? Wyjątkiem jest błąd, który występuje w czasie wykonywania programu. Jednak podczas uruchamiania programu języki programowania generują wyjątek, który należy obsłużyć
XPath używa poleceń Contains, Sibling, Ancestor Commandes do znalezienia elementu sieci Web dla naszego skryptu testowego w selenie.
Dwukrotne kliknięcie w Selenium Czynność dwukrotnego kliknięcia w sterowniku sieciowym Selenium można wykonać za pomocą klasy Actions. Klasa Actions to predefiniowana klasa w sterowniku sieciowym Selenium używana do wykonywania wielu klawiatur i mo
W selenie & bdquo; Waits & rdquo; odgrywają ważną rolę w wykonywaniu testów. W tym samouczku poznasz różne aspekty zarówno „Niejawnych” i „Wulgaryzmy” czeka w Selenie
Co to jest pasek przewijania? Pasek przewijania umożliwia poruszanie się po ekranie w kierunku poziomym lub pionowym, jeśli przewijanie bieżącej strony nie mieści się w widocznym obszarze ekranu. Służy do przesuwania wygranej
Co to jest repozytorium obiektów? Repozytorium obiektów to wspólne miejsce przechowywania wszystkich obiektów. W kontekście Selenium WebDriver, obiekty byłyby zazwyczaj lokalizatorami używanymi do jednoznacznej identyfikacji sieci web el
Możesz dostosować profil Firefoksa do swoich wymagań automatyzacji Selenium. Ponadto Firefox lub jakakolwiek inna przeglądarka obsługuje ustawienia certyfikatów SSL
Selenium obsługuje Python i dlatego może być używany z Selenium do testowania. Python jest łatwy w porównaniu z innymi językami programowania, ponieważ jest znacznie mniej rozwlekły, a interfejsy API Pythona umożliwiają łączenie się z
Plik cookie HTTP zawiera informacje o użytkowniku i jego preferencjach. Przechowuje informacje za pomocą pary klucz-wartość. Jest to mały fragment danych wysyłany z aplikacji internetowej i przechowywany w sieci Web Br
W testach Flash musisz sprawdzić, czy wideo flash, gry, filmy itp. Działają zgodnie z oczekiwaniami, czy nie. Testowanie funkcjonalności lampy błyskowej nazywane jest testowaniem Flash.
SoapUI to najpopularniejsze narzędzie do testowania funkcjonalnego typu open source do testowania API. Najprostszym i najłatwiejszym sposobem integracji Selenium z Soapui jest użycie Groovy.
W Selenium TestNG udostępnia swój domyślny system raportowania. Aby ulepszyć funkcję raportowania, pomocny jest dodatkowy raport XSLT. Ma również bardziej przyjazny dla użytkownika interfejs użytkownika
Git Hub to platforma współpracy. Jest zbudowany na git. Pozwala zachować zarówno lokalne, jak i zdalne kopie projektu. Projekt, który możesz opublikować wśród członków swojego zespołu w miarę ich c
Ant to narzędzie do budowania języka Java. Ant używany do kompilacji kodu, wdrażania, procesu wykonywania. Plik Build.xml używany do konfigurowania celów wykonania przy użyciu narzędzia Ant. Ant można uruchomić z wiersza poleceń lub odpowiedniej wtyczki IDE, takiej jak eclipse.
Selenium Intellij to IDE, które pomaga pisać lepszy i szybszy kod. Intellij może być używany w opcji Java Bean i Eclipse. W tym samouczku dowiesz się - Co to są wymagania wstępne intelliJ do Int
JavaScriptExecutor to interfejs, który pomaga wykonywać JavaScript przez Selenium Webdriver. JavaScriptExecutor udostępnia dwie metody & bdquo; & bdquo; skrypt wykonywania & bdquo; & rdquo; & & bdquo; & bdquo; executeAsyncScript & quot; & rdquo; aby uruchomić javascript w wybranym oknie lub na bieżącej stronie.
Certyfikat SSL (Secure Socket Layer) zapewnia bezpieczną transformację danych na serwerze i aplikacji klienckiej przy użyciu silnego standardu szyfrowania lub podpisu cyfrowego. Trzeba zainstalować certyfikat SSL
Ajax to technika używana do tworzenia szybkich i dynamicznych stron internetowych. Ta technika jest asynchroniczna i wykorzystuje połączenie JavaScript i XML. Metody oczekiwania, których może używać Selenium Webdriver.
W tym samouczku, jak automatycznie pobierać i instalować, pisać skrypty, motyka do użycia i jak automatycznie przesyłać plik w Selenium Webdriver.
Klasa Robot w pakiecie AWT służy do generowania zdarzeń klawiatury / myszy w celu interakcji z oknami systemu operacyjnego i aplikacjami natywnymi.
Wprowadzenie Log4j Log4j to szybki, elastyczny i niezawodny framework do logowania (APIS) napisany w Javie, opracowany na początku 1996 roku. Jest rozprowadzany na licencji Apache Software License. Log4J został przeniesiony
Zrzuty ekranu są pożądane do analizy błędów. Selenium może automatycznie robić zrzuty ekranu podczas wykonywania. Musisz wpisać instancję cast WebDriver